Genetic heterogeneity in tuberous sclerosis.
L.A.J. Janssen,L. A. Sandkuyl,E. C. Merkens,J.A. Maat-Kievit,Julian R. Sampson,P. Fleury,R.C.M. Hennekam,Gerard Grosveld,Dick Lindhout,Dicky J. J. Halley +9 more
TL;DR: An approach combining multipoint linkage analysis and heterogeneity tests that has enabled us to obtain significant evidence for locus heterogeneity after studying a relatively small number of families supports a model with two different loci independently causing the disease.

Evidence for genetic-heterogeneity in tuberous sclerosis
Julian R. Sampson,John R.W. Yates,L A Pirrit,P. Fleury,Ingrid Winship,Peter Beighton,J M Connor +6 more
TL;DR: The question of genetic heterogeneity in tuberous sclerosis was addressed by genetic linkage studies in eight affected families using nine polymorphic markers and analysis of two point lod scores showed significant evidence for genetic heterogeneity.
